Rolls-Royce 10336 - Part Number 10336
The Rolls-Royce 10336 is a premier automation product renowned for its robust design, exceptional input/output capacity, and unparalleled performance in demanding industrial environments. Engineered specifically for critical applications in the power industry, petrochemical sector, and general automation, the 10336 stands out as a reliable and efficient solution that meets the rigorous demands of modern industrial automation. At the heart of the Rolls-Royce 10336 lies an advanced processing unit capable of handling complex real-time data streams with high precision. Featuring an input/output configuration that supports up to 256 digital inputs and 128 digital outputs, as well as analog interfaces for seamless integration with sensors and control devices, the 10336 enables precise control and monitoring across various automation processes. Its architecture is optimized for low latency and high throughput, ensuring rapid response times essential in critical operations such as turbine control in the power industry or process monitoring in petrochemical plants. Durability is a hallmark of the Rolls-Royce 10336. Designed to withstand harsh industrial conditions, including extreme temperatures, vibration, and electromagnetic interference, it is built with ruggedized components and encased in a corrosion-resistant housing.
This ensures prolonged operational life with minimal downtime, a crucial factor in industries where system reliability directly impacts safety and productivity. Performance metrics of the 10336 include a processing speed that exceeds 1 GHz with multi-threading capabilities, memory capacity supporting up to 8 GB of RAM, and enhanced fault tolerance through redundant power supplies and fail-safe features. These specifications allow the 10336 to operate continuously in mission-critical environments, providing accurate data processing and control without interruption. In real-world applications, the Rolls-Royce 10336 excels in scenarios such as power generation plant automation, where it manages turbine controls, load balancing, and safety interlocks. In the petrochemical industry, it is instrumental in process automation—regulating temperature, pressure, and flow rates to optimize production while maintaining safety standards. General automation applications benefit from the 10336’s adaptability, which supports integration with SCADA systems, PLCs, and other supervisory control architectures, enabling seamless process automation across diverse industrial setups.
